Fuel Gage

United States
When the ignition is on, the fuel gage shows about
how much fuel is left in the fuel tank.
An arrow on the fuel gage indicates the side of the
vehicle the fuel door is on.
The gage will first indicate empty before the vehicle
is out of fuel, but the vehicle's fuel tank should be
filled soon.
